Originally posted by Adidas_Boy


I don't think I understand what you mean. . . I have MB Quart 6.5S and they fit perfect in my stock openings, no problems at all fitting.
Odd, I have MB Quart QM160's, and they don't fit. Went to Magnolia Hi-Fi to talk to them about it, and they said they almost always have to put a plywood plate around the holes on stock doors for MBQuarts to make new screw holes, because the lips are too big.

I did this, and put them in my car, and they rubbed very bad against the door panel, and the door panel didn't fit on all the way. Enough to where it wasn't noticeable to the casual observer, but still not on right.

I put some Focal 6.5's in there, and they fit perfectly.
